
Ribut Eko Suyanto
Ribut Eko Suyanto is the Deputy of Operations for Search and Rescue and Readiness at Basarnas, Indonesia, known for his role in coordinating search efforts and providing updates during maritime incidents, including the recent identification of a potential wreck site of the KMP Tunu Pratama Jaya in the Bali Strait.
